Knightsland Farm House, 16th-century farmhouse in South Mimms, England

Knightsland Farm House is a 16th-century timber-framed farmhouse in South Mimms with two stories and an attic space. The building features three windows on its main front with brick casing and is characterized by a through passage with a panelled screen that leads into the hall.

The house was built in the 16th century and substantially rebuilt around 1600, with its exterior refaced in the late 17th century. Later additions expanded the building as the needs of the household changed over generations.

The wall paintings on the first floor depict four scenes from the Prodigal Son story, created between 1590 and 1610 with floral friezes in brocade patterns. These artworks show the religious beliefs and artistic skill of the people who lived here during that era.

The building can be viewed from the exterior and displays its timber-framed structure and roof gables clearly. Visitors should note the separate gabled roof on the rear turret section, which distinguishes it from the main structure.

At the rear of the house stands a full-height square stair turret with its own gabled roof, giving the building an unusual asymmetrical form. This architectural feature was a practical solution for accessing upper floors in larger farmhouses of that period.
